The microbial limit test consists of culturing samples of your drug products below proper circumstances to encourage the growth of feasible microorganisms. The sort and amount of microorganisms tested depend on factors like the supposed use with the solution, its route of administration, and regulatory prerequisites. Widespread microorganisms tested in microbial limit testing involve microorganisms, yeast, and mold. The testing is usually performed working with selective tradition media and incubation conditions that favor The expansion of certain microbial species.
With the drug microbiological limit test, it is feasible to be familiar with whether the drug is contaminated and its diploma of contamination, to learn the supply of the contamination, and to undertake acceptable methods to manage it to be sure the standard of the drug.

Distillation Distillation units present chemical and microbial purification by way of thermal vaporization, mist elimination, and h2o here vapor condensation. A range of styles is out there which includes solitary outcome, numerous influence, and vapor compression. The latter two configurations are Ordinarily used in more substantial units as a result of their making capacity and efficiency. Distilled drinking water programs involve various feed drinking water controls than expected by membrane units. For distillation, because of consideration have to be specified to prior removing of hardness and silica impurities that may foul or corrode the heat transfer surfaces and also prior elimination of Individuals impurities that would volatize and condense together with the water vapor.
